DE Luis Castillo will be released before a $1 million signing bonus becomes due next month, according to the San Diego-Union Tribune. Castillo, who is owed 3.9 million in salary in 2012, missed 15 games last season after he broke a tibia in Week 1 against the Vikings. TheChargers may re-sign Castillo for a lower deal after he tests free agency.
